Reserve Policies

  • Faculty members may place books/DVDs from the Circulating collection of the Library Catalog (WebPAC) on Reserves for the current Semester when a course is taught. Library items can be retrieved from the stacks by a staff member if requested. Personal copies of books/DVDs are also accepted. 
  • The library will take all normal precautions for the safety of personal items. The library will not be responsible for the abuse or loss of materials by students.
  • Loan Periods are specified by the instructor:

    • 3 hour loan - Library Use only

    • 3 hour loan - outside of the Library

    • 1 day loan - any item with a 1 day loan period may be checked out of the Library and returned the following day

    • 3 day or 7day loan - Item may be checked out for the length of time designated

    • Library Use Only - Library use only items must remain in the Library for a time period of approximately  2-hours

  • If the library does not own a desired book, you may request a "rush" order to be placed for acquisition. 2-6 weeks may be needed for this process. Please discuss acquisition requests with a departmental liaison librarian.
  • Faculty needing assistance for inclusion of a permalink to a specific journal article into their Canvas Courses should seek the assistance of their liaison librarian. For further guidance on other Canvas issues, contact TLT via Canvas 24/7 Support Hotline (Faculty) at   (833)735-0335 or  tltoffice@widener.edu.     
  • A book in circulation may be recalled at any time to be placed on reserve by a faculty member for a current course, with a 14-day lead time to allow the book to be returned.
